Overview

**dapagliflozin + sparsentan** is an oral combination therapy comprising **dapagliflozin**, a sodium-glucose cotransporter 2 (SGLT2) inhibitor, and **sparsentan**, a dual antagonist of the endothelin type A receptor and angiotensin II type 1 receptor. Dapagliflozin reduces renal glucose reabsorption, lowering blood glucose and providing nephroprotection. Sparsentan blocks pathogenic signaling of endothelin-1 and angiotensin II in the kidney, exerting antiproteinuric, antifibrotic, and anti-inflammatory effects. The combination is being studied primarily for the treatment of chronic kidney diseases such as IgA nephropathy and focal segmental glomerulosclerosis, especially in patients with persistent proteinuria on standard therapy.
